Set Up a VIP Subscription Enrollment in Phoenix
Setting up a VIP subscription in Phoenix requires configuring billing types, creating products, and linking them to define the enrollment flow.
This setup allows you to:
-
Enroll customers automatically after a direct purchase.
-
Offer a trial period (VIP initial).
-
Transition customers into a recurring subscription (VIP recurring).
In this guide, you’ll learn how to configure each component and connect them into a complete VIP subscription flow.
Prerequisites
Before you begin, ensure that:
-
You have access to the Phoenix Dashboard.
-
A store is already created and available.
-
You have permission to manage Billing Types and Products.
Create Billing Types
Billing Types define how and when customers are charged. For this flow, you will create three billing types: Direct Sale, VIP Initial (trial), and VIP Recurring.
Create Direct Sale
This billing type is used for the initial one-time purchase that enrolls the customer into the subscription flow.
To create the Direct Sale billing type:
-
Go to eCommerce.
-
Select Billing Type.
-
Click + Add Billing Type.
-
Complete the form using the following values:
-
Select Client: Your client name
-
Select Store: Your store name
-
Billing Type Name: Enter
Direct Sale -
Billing Type: Select
Direct Sale -
Reporting Type: Select
Direct Sale -
Billing Frequency: Select
One Time -
Payment Delay: Select
No -
Payment Mode: Select
Sell -
Next Billing Type: Select
No -
Next Billing Product: Select
No -
Use Same Product as Main Order: Optional
-
Set as Default: Optional
-
-
Click Confirm.
Create VIP Initial (Trial)
This billing type defines the trial period before the recurring subscription begins.
To create the VIP Initial billing type:
-
Click + Add Billing Type.
-
Complete the form using the following values:
-
Select Client: Your client name
-
Select Store: Your store name
-
Billing Type Name: Enter
VIP Initial -
Billing Type: Select
Subscription -
Reporting Type: Select
VIP Initial -
Billing Frequency: Select
One Time -
Payment Delay: Enter your trial period (for example,
14 days) -
Payment Mode: Select
Authorize(2 minutes) -
Next Billing Type: Select
No -
Next Billing Product: Select
No -
Use Same Product as Main Order: Optional
-
Set as Default: Optional
-
-
Click Confirm.
Create VIP Recurring
This billing type defines the ongoing subscription after the trial period.
To create the VIP Recurring billing type:
-
Click + Add Billing Type.
-
Complete the form using the following values:
-
Select Client: Your client name
-
Select Store: Your store name
-
Billing Type Name: Enter
VIP Recurring -
Billing Type: Select
Subscription -
Reporting Type: Select
Monthly Rebill -
Billing Frequency: Select
Multiple -
Payment Delay: Enter your billing cycle (for example,
30 days) -
Payment Mode: Select
Authorize(2 minutes) -
Next Billing Type: Select
No -
Next Billing Product: Select
No -
Use Same Product as Main Order: Optional
-
Set as Default: Optional
-
-
Click Confirm.
Create Products
After creating the billing types, you need to create products and assign the corresponding billing types.
Create VIP Initial Product
This product is used during the trial period.
To create the VIP Initial product:
-
Go to eCommerce.
-
Select Products.
-
Click View.
-
Click + Add Product.
-
Complete the form using the following values:
-
Name: Enter
VIP Initial -
Product Type: Select
VIP Initial -
Price: Enter your price (for example,
$29.99) -
Status: Select
Draft -
Publish Scope: Select
Web
-
-
Click Add Product.
After creating the product, the Edit Product screen opens automatically.
-
In the Billing Type field, select VIP Initial.
-
Click Update.
Create VIP Recurring Product
This product is used for the ongoing subscription.
To create the VIP Recurring product:
-
Click Add Product.
-
Complete the form using the following values:
-
Name Enter
VIP Recurring -
Price Enter your price (for example,
$29.99) -
Status Select
Draft -
Publish Scope Select
Web
-
-
Click Add Product.
After creating the product, the Edit Product screen opens automatically.
-
In the Billing Type field, select VIP Recurring.
-
Click Update.
Link Billing Types for Enrollment
Once all billing types are created, you must link them to define the subscription flow.
To link the billing types:
-
Go back to eCommerce.
-
Select Billing Type.
-
Locate VIP Initial and click the edit icon.
-
In the Add Next Billing Type field, select
Yesto access further options. -
Select VIP Recurring from the dropdown in the Select Next Billing Type field.
-
Click Confirm.
How the VIP Subscription Flow Works
After completing the setup, the system processes the subscription as follows:
-
A customer completes a Direct Sale.
-
The customer is automatically enrolled in VIP Initial.
-
The trial period begins (for example, 14 days).
-
After the delay, the customer is charged for VIP Recurring.
-
The subscription continues based on the defined billing cycle (for example, every 30 days).
Your VIP subscription enrollment is now fully configured.
Customers will automatically move from the initial purchase to the trial period and then into a recurring subscription without manual intervention.
